Alongside Modern Art Oxford's exhibition with Kiki Smith: I am a Wanderer, featuring her intricate Jacquard tapestries, the Creative Space plays host to a Loom Computer Synthesiser created by Owl Project, allowing you to connect a loom to electronic sound.

Inspired by their 2014 Barnaby Festival commission to create a work for Paradise Mill – one of Macclesfield’s silk museums – Owl Project have created a Loom Computer Synthesiser. It simulates how the jacquard loom used punch cards to make patterned cloth, and explores what happens if you try to connect a jacquard loom to electronic sound-making technology.

Come along to the Creative Space to weave your own patterns and create your own electronic soundtrack using punch cards.
